Skip to main content

FIRST_VALUE (SQL)

ウィンドウ・フレーム内の field 列の最初の値を、その列の他の各値に割り当てるウィンドウ関数。

構文

FIRST_VALUE(field)

説明

FIRST_VALUE は、最初の行の field 列の値を使用して、特定のウィンドウ・フレームのすべての行に割り当てます。FIRST_VALUEROWS 節をサポートします。

すべての値の前に NULL を照合し、最初の行の field の値が NULL の場合にウィンドウ内のすべての行が NULL になるようにすることに注意してください。

引数

field

そのウィンドウ・フレームのすべての行に割り当てる値を指定する列。

以下の例は、各都市の Country 列の最初の値を返します。

SELECT FIRST_VALUE(Country) OVER (PARTITION BY City)

関連項目

FeedbackOpens in a new tab